What is a Rolling Tray?

Let's start with the fundamentals before delving into the details. A flat surface, typically made of metal, wood, or plastic, is called a rolling tray and is used for rolling cones. To avoid spills and keep your herb in one place, it often has raised edges. There are many different sizes and designs of rolling trays, so it's simple to choose one that matches your preferences.

Types of Rolling Trays

1. Metal Rolling Trays

Due to their strength and stylish design, metal rolling trays are a popular option. They are frequently crafted from aluminum or stainless steel, which makes them rust- and scratch-resistant and simple to maintain. These trays come in a variety of sizes, so you may pick one that precisely suits your rolling needs.

2. Wooden Rolling Trays

Rolling trays made of wood have a timeless, rural appeal. They are typically crafted from premium woods like walnut or bamboo. Wooden trays are frequently made with complex designs and craftsmanship, making them both useful and beautiful.

3. Plastic Rolling Trays

Rolling trays made of plastic are lightweight and inexpensive. They are available in a variety of hues and patterns, making it simple to select one that complements your own taste. Plastic trays are a wonderful option for novices even though they might not be as sturdy as metal or wood.

4. Rolling Tray Kits

Additional accessories like rolling papers, filters, and storage compartments are frequently included with rolling tray packages. These kits are ideal for customers seeking a comprehensive remedy for their rolling requirements.

Factors to Consider When Choosing the Best Rolling Tray

Now that you are aware of the various rolling trays available, let's examine the important elements to take into account while making your choice.

1. Size Matters

If you intend to use your rolling tray for gatherings or parties, its size is important. While smaller trays are more portable and convenient to store, larger trays offer greater workspace.

2. Material

Your rolling tray's longevity and attractiveness are impacted by its material. Think about which you would prefer: plastic's low cost, wood's warmth, or metal's sleekness.

3. Design and Style

Rolling trays can be made in a variety of styles, from simple to elaborate. Pick one that complements your sense of style and makes the ritual more enjoyable.

4. Portability

A small rolling tray that fits in your purse or pocket might be the ideal option for you if you're constantly on the road.

5. Additional Features

Some rolling trays come with extra features like storage compartments, ashtrays, or built-in holders for rolling accessories. Think about what additional features would enhance your rolling process.

6. Price Range

Rolling trays are available in a wide price range, so set a budget that works for you and explore options within that range.

7. Easy to Clean

Consider how easy it is to clean your rolling tray. Metal trays are usually the easiest to wipe clean, while wooden trays may require more maintenance.
